>> I am trying to program an Atmega32 on a stk500 development board by
>> using avrdude.
>>
>>> avrdude -p atmega32 -P /dev/ttyS5 -c stk500v2 -U flash:w:MessageBoard.hex
>> starts the programming proces. And usaly it programs the chip but it is
>> very slow (writing 4224 bytes of flash takes about 118 seconds) and
>> produces a lot of stk500_2_ReceiveMessage90; timeout messages.
>>
>> I asume this is not 'normal' behaviour. Does anybody have any
>> suggestions to speed up the programming proces and eliminate the timeout
>> messages? Is the problem with avrdude, the serial drivers or with the
>> stk500?
>>
>> I use avrdude on Ubuntu 6.06, kernel 2.6.15-23-amd64 but have
>> experienced the same problem on my labtop (ubuntu 5.10, kernel
>> 2.6.12-10-386) on both avrdude 5 as 5.1
>
> This is a longshot, but is there a possibility that some other program
> has the serial port open? I have gotten timeouts like this when I've
> had kermit running simultaneously with avrdude.
